Pliable, transparent grid structures made of stainless steel rope from the
Jakob INOX LINE series are multifunctional and durable: mounted on railings or
in staircases, they provide support and guidance; on faades, they can be used as
training systems for plants; in large rooms, they will create subtle accents as filigreed
partitions. The Jakob INOX LINE Webnet was subjected to numerous tests and complies
with all applicable standards: As a permanent protective and safety net for bridges or
observation platforms, it is absolutely UV- and weather-resistant, unlike conventional knotted
plastic fiber nets.
The Jakob INOX LINE Webnet has the skin-like characteristics of a diaphragm. It can form a
plane surface but can also be tensioned into three-dimensional forms featuring funnel-type, cylindrical, or spherical shapes.

A fabric of particular resilience and flexibility, a net whose strands are neither knotted nor
crossed: the Jakob INOX LINE Webnet is a construction based on stainless steel wire ropes that lie
parallel in pairs connected and reciprocally curved by offset sleeves.
The net construction can be pulled apart like an accordion, producing a spring force that varies
depending on the mesh aperture and wire-rope thickness.
The Jakob INOX LINE Webnet is a vibrant, premium-quality product: the mesh aperture (variable, from very tight to very wide) and the wire-rope diameter (1.0 mm,
1.5 mm, 2.0 mm, and 3.0 mm) determine its functionality and aesthetics. Most
Jakob INOX LINE components are made from the AISI 316 material group.

The characteristics of the ambient atmosphere determine the selection of the most suitable materials.
A distinction is made between rural, urban, industrial, and
maritime climates.
The urban and industrial atmospheres typically contain aggressive substances in the form of carbon-containing particles and
sulfur dioxide (SO2).
Chloride ion-containing aerosols are found in maritime climates.
The rural atmosphere is comparatively benign.
Most Jakob INOX LINE components are made from the
AISI 316 material group.
